2004 TNA World X Cup Tournament - Rules

Rules

The competition is divided into four rounds.

  • In Round One, there will be a gauntlet involving all 16 wrestlers. The winner gets three points for their respective team
  • In Round Two, there are two tag team matches. The winners get two points for their respective teams.
  • In Round Three, there will be a Ladder match involving 1 member from each team. The winner gets four points for their respective teams.
  • In Round Four, there will be a Ultimate X match involving 1 member from the top 3 teams. (The team in last place is eliminated). The winner gets five points for there respective team.
  • In the event of a tie, the captains of the two teams will compete in a singles match in order to determine the champion.
